A DICHOTOMY THEOREM FOR THE ELLENTUCK TOPOLOGY

摘要

Results are deduced from the following dichotomy which reduces descriptive properties concerning the Ellentuck topology to two well-known examples. Theorem: Every nonempty perfect set in the Ellentuck topology contains a closed copy of the Sorgenfrey line or a closed copy of the rational numbers. This leads to a Marczewski-Burstin representation for Marczewski sets in the Ellentuck topology.
